CV-PC On Forklifts Trucks

In Vehicle PC’s Used By Allied Glass

Allied Glass is a supplier of luxury glass packaging, creating beautiful and ground-breaking containers for a raft of international brands. Storing most of its stock in a Leeds warehouse, the products are moved by forklift truck.
The loading of each product onto a forklift truck is recorded by the driver scanning the product’s barcode using a wireless barcode scanner. This device transmits the barcode information to a PC on-board the forklift truck, which runs a bespoke internally developed programme that, processes the data and transmits it to the company’s back-office servers, in real time, over Wi-Fi.

Allied reviewed the Commercial Vehicle -Computer because they were unhappy with the existing on-board computers, which were tablet based. The main issue was that the tablets had very poor Wi-Fi performance, resulting in frequent network dropouts as the forklifts moved around the warehouse. Thus causing delays in goods reaching their intended destination, which in-turn was having a negative effect on the site’s productivity.

The solution was a Commercial Vehicle PC combined with dual high-gain Wi-Fi antennas mounted on the forklift’s roof, a 10.4” touch sensitive screen was mounted in the forklifts cab.

Russell Bavester, IT at Allied said “We are very pleased with this solution, CV-PC has significantly improved our Wi-Fi connectivity. These vehicle computers easily outperforms our existing solution even when the same antennas are used, and our existing barcode scanners work seamlessly. We have also been able to free up a bit of room in the cab, as the previous tablet was very bulky.”

The HD PowerJump is a compact quality retro fit product for a commercial vehicle service van, connecting to two heavy duty 12 volt batteries, the HDJP provides automatic charge to the two batteries while on road to a service call. Once the ignition is switched off the HDJP will provide a stable 24 volts for servicing a truck or trailer. Switching the ignition on would automatically reset the HDJP to a 12 volt charge cycle. In addition there is a an override button if the van is required to be running while servicing.

Earlier this year the Driver and Vehicle Standards Agency (DVSA) published a revised version of its Guide to Maintaining Roadworthiness.

Probably the brake testing requirement is the biggest burden on operators, but using a decelerometer within the inspection is no more of an inconvenience to the inspection routine.
Since the revision aide automotive has seen a further interest in the portable decelerometer BrakeCheck. Many operators have enquired and purchased a PC or printer kit to meet to the guidance.
Although the guidance advises that a ‘calibrated roller brake tester‘ (RBT) is used on each safety inspection, the DVSA also accept the use of an approved and calibrated decelerometer to carry out the three additional tests to the annual MOT roller brake test.
As the consequences of non-compliance with the required standards can be very severe and include prohibition, fines or prosecution, operators are advised to ensure that they are familiar with all the changes within the DVSA guidance.
Decelerometers have moved on significantly from the old mechanical brake testers such as Tapley Brake Meters. Being electronic there is a much higher accuracy and additional information such as average deceleration, a left/right pull measurement, speed at braking and stopping distance. All tests are time and date stamped.
Print outs as preferred by the DVSA can be achieved by downloading to a PC or printing via the portable printer communicating over infra red with the BrakeCheck.

The Old Mechanical Brake Tester Tapley Now Retired As DVSA Say A Print Out Required

For almost 100 years Tapley brake testers have been the market leading portable brake testing equipment.

Results of Tapley Brake meter tests have been accepted as evidence of braking efficiency in Courts of Law throughout the world.

But now it seems the Tapley Brake Tester may well be retired in the UK, recent guidance from the DVSA now says a brake test must be printed for inspection records.

Decelerometers have moved on significantly from the old mechanical brake testers such as Tapley Decelerometer. Being electronic BrakeCheck has a much higher accuracy and additional information such as average deceleration, a left/right pull measurement, speed at braking and stopping distance. All tests are time and date stamped.

DVSA Recommend 4 Brake Tests Per Year!!

Document :Guide to maintaining road worthiness
Commercial goods and passenger carrying vehicles (Revised 2014)

Section 5: Safety inspection and repair facilities

Extract –
“Therefore it is normally expected that the vehicle or trailer should complete at least three successful brake efficiency tests spread throughout year in addition to the annual MOT test.”

BrakeCheck is a portable brake tester that works from the principle of measuring deceleration or Brake Efficiency, BrakeCheck has been proved to be a good indication of brake performance and cost effective for any workshop. Over 15,000 BrakeCheck’s have been purchased since it’s introduction in January 2003, and is now a standard tool for any vehicle workshop.

In addition to BrakeCheck Standard which is marketed towards Car, Van Truck and Bus / Coaches, BrakeCheck For Truck &Trailers is ideal for trailer operating companies.

aide automotive also recommend the use of an Infra Red Thermometer to check individual wheels via temperature. This in conjunction with a decelerometer print out would be the perfect 3 times a year brake test for any commercial vehicle.

To meet the maintenance required for the fleet, workshop manager invested in the TrailerCheck 4 Vans, trailer light, Air Brake and ISO tester.

Designed as a mounted trailer tester in a Van or workshop the TrailerCheck 4 Vans is a One Man Trailer Service tool with the option of ECU Trailer Diagnostics.

The Trailer Air Brake And Light Tester is an intelligent unit and has the capability to power multiple trailers without the inconvenience of continually recharging external batteries.

A single trailer service engineer can be under a trailer activating brakes and reading pressures.

Switching brakes on and off allows the user to look for wear in s cams and faulty slack adjusters. The digital pressure gauge measures pressure at the brake chamber, ideal for setting load sensing valves.

EBS Trailers can be tested for CAN line integrity, a quick and simple test to confirm the CAN lines.
